Article 227(1) of the Constitution explicitly grants every High Court the power of 'superintendence over all courts and tribunals' throughout its territorial jurisdiction. This is a constitutional oversight power distinct from appellate jurisdiction, enabling High Courts to ensure proper administration of justice.
